These sterling silver Belt Buckles were cast from sterling silver flatware.  They were cast in the dates on the back for a local physician by Hanover Bros., of Mechanicsville, VA.  They are quite beautiful and make a wonderful impression when worn.  There were a few solid silver buckles which were cast for officers during the Civil War.  They were jeweler made.  Now you may own one of these one of a kind buckles.
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 

This is a Jensen Manufacturing Co. Woodworking Shop Style No. 100. It was made by the Jensen Co. from 1947-1985. It is marked "Jensen Mfg. Co., Jeannette, PA., Style No. 100". It has a miniature table saw, planner, trip hammer, drill, and a milling machine. It is all worked from a center shaft and belts. The miniatures are mounted on a wooden board that is approximately 12 x 14 inches. Someone along the line has added gold paint to accent the toy.  PRICE $200.00 plus actual shipping.
